United Company RUSAL was founded in March 2007 through the merger of RUSAL, SUAL, and the alumina assets of Glencore. [1] Kamensk-Uralsky Metallurgical Works which earlier belonged to the SUAL group was not merged to RUSAL and exists as an independent company.
